回答編集履歴

2

追記

2017/06/13 07:22

投稿

m.ts10806
m.ts10806

スコア80850

test CHANGED
@@ -4,8 +4,32 @@
4
4
 
5
5
  ```javascript
6
6
 
7
+ var datalist = {
8
+
9
+ data1: "hoge1",
10
+
11
+ data2: "hoge2"
12
+
13
+ }
14
+
15
+
16
+
17
+ localStorage.setItem("datalist", JSON.stringify(datalist));
18
+
19
+
20
+
21
+ //取り出してパースする
22
+
7
23
  datalist = JSON.parse(localStorage.getItem("datalist"));
8
24
 
9
25
  datalist["data3"] = "hoge3";
10
26
 
27
+
28
+
29
+ //保存する
30
+
31
+ localStorage.setItem("datalist", JSON.stringify(datalist));
32
+
33
+
34
+
11
35
  ```

1

メソッド名ミス修正

2017/06/13 07:22

投稿

m.ts10806
m.ts10806

スコア80850

test CHANGED
@@ -4,7 +4,7 @@
4
4
 
5
5
  ```javascript
6
6
 
7
- datalist = JSON.parse(localStorage.setItem("datalist"));
7
+ datalist = JSON.parse(localStorage.getItem("datalist"));
8
8
 
9
9
  datalist["data3"] = "hoge3";
10
10